Understanding the Requirements for Car Rentals
Before diving into the specifics of renting a car without a credit card, it's essential to understand the standard requirements for car rentals. Rental companies typically require a credit card for several reasons. Firstly, credit cards serve as a security deposit, covering potential damages or additional charges incurred during the rental period. Secondly, credit cards allow rental companies to easily process payments for the rental fee and any extra services. Thirdly, many rental agreements stipulate that the renter must have a valid credit card in their name to ensure financial responsibility. However, these are not the only options available.
Most major car rental companies, like Hertz, Enterprise, Avis, and Budget, generally prefer credit cards due to the ease of processing transactions and security. These companies often require a major credit card, such as Visa, MasterCard, American Express, or Discover, to secure the rental. The credit card ensures that the renter can cover any unforeseen costs, such as damages, late return fees, or traffic violations. Additionally, using a credit card often streamlines the rental process, making it quicker and more efficient. Options for Renting a Car in Miami Without a Credit Card
So, how can you rent a car in Miami without a credit card? Here are several viable options:
1. Debit Card Rentals
Many rental agencies now accept debit cards, but with certain conditions. Typically, you'll need to provide additional documentation, such as a valid driver's license, proof of address (like a utility bill), and sometimes a recent pay stub or bank statement. Some companies might also conduct a credit check to assess your financial reliability. Furthermore, the debit card must be linked to a checking account with sufficient funds to cover the rental cost and any potential security deposit. Be prepared for a hold to be placed on your account, which can take several days to be released after the rental period. Always check the specific requirements of the rental agency beforehand to ensure you have all the necessary documents and meet their criteria.
2. Cash Rentals
A few rental companies in Miami allow you to pay with cash, but this is less common and usually involves a more stringent verification process. You'll likely need to provide extensive documentation, including proof of insurance, references, and a substantial cash deposit. The deposit can be significantly higher than what you'd pay with a credit card, sometimes reaching several hundred dollars. Additionally, the rental company might require a credit check to mitigate their risk. While cash rentals offer an alternative for those without credit cards, they often come with more hurdles and paperwork. It's crucial to inquire about all the requirements and potential fees before committing to a cash rental.
3. Prepaid Cards
Prepaid cards, such as Visa or MasterCard prepaid cards, can sometimes be used for car rentals, but acceptance varies widely. Some rental agencies treat prepaid cards similarly to debit cards, requiring additional documentation and a credit check. Others may not accept them at all, as prepaid cards don't offer the same level of security as traditional credit cards. If you plan to use a prepaid card, it's essential to contact the rental agency in advance to confirm their policy and understand any limitations. Ensure the card has sufficient funds to cover the rental cost and any potential deposit, as some companies may place a hold on the card for the duration of the rental.
4. Peer-to-Peer Car Rentals
Peer-to-peer car rental services like Turo can provide more flexible options. Turo allows you to rent cars directly from individual owners, and some owners may be more lenient with payment methods, potentially accepting debit cards or cash. Each owner sets their own rental terms, so you'll need to review the specific requirements for each listing. Peer-to-peer rentals can also offer a wider variety of vehicles and potentially lower prices compared to traditional rental agencies. However, it's crucial to read reviews and check the owner's rating to ensure a reliable and safe rental experience. Always communicate clearly with the owner regarding payment methods and any other concerns before booking.
5. Rent from Smaller, Local Agencies
Smaller, local car rental agencies in Miami might have more flexible policies than the big national chains. These agencies are often more willing to work with customers who don't have a credit card, offering alternative payment options like debit cards or cash with less stringent requirements. However, it's essential to do your due diligence and research the agency thoroughly before booking. Check online reviews, verify their insurance coverage, and ensure they have a good reputation. While local agencies can provide a convenient solution, they may not offer the same level of customer service or vehicle selection as larger companies. Always prioritize safety and reliability when choosing a rental agency.
Tips for a Smooth Car Rental Experience Without a Credit Card
To ensure a hassle-free car rental experience in Miami without a credit card, keep these tips in mind:
1. Plan Ahead
Start your research early. Contact different rental agencies well in advance to inquire about their policies on debit cards, cash, and prepaid cards. This will give you ample time to gather the necessary documentation and understand any specific requirements. Booking in advance can also help you secure better rates and availability, especially during peak travel seasons. Don't wait until the last minute to start your search, as this could limit your options and increase the chances of encountering difficulties.
2. Gather Required Documents
Prepare all the necessary documents ahead of time. This typically includes a valid driver's license, proof of address, and possibly a recent pay stub or bank statement. If using a debit card, ensure it is linked to a checking account with sufficient funds to cover the rental cost and any potential security deposit. Having all your documents ready will expedite the rental process and demonstrate your preparedness to the rental agency.
3. Read the Fine Print
Carefully review the rental agreement before signing anything. Pay close attention to the terms and conditions regarding payment methods, security deposits, insurance coverage, and potential fees. Understand your responsibilities as a renter and what is expected of you. If anything is unclear, don't hesitate to ask the rental agent for clarification. Knowing your rights and obligations will help you avoid any surprises or misunderstandings during the rental period.
4. Inspect the Car Thoroughly
Before driving off the lot, thoroughly inspect the car for any existing damages. Document any scratches, dents, or other imperfections, and report them to the rental agency immediately. Take photos or videos as evidence of the car's condition before you leave. This will protect you from being held liable for damages that were already present when you picked up the vehicle. A detailed inspection can save you time and money in the long run.
5. Be Aware of Extra Fees
Be mindful of potential extra fees, such as late return fees, mileage overage charges, and refueling costs. Return the car on time and with the agreed-upon fuel level to avoid these additional expenses. Familiarize yourself with the rental agency's policies on extra fees and how they are calculated. Planning your trip and managing your time effectively can help you avoid these unnecessary costs.
